Abstract
A telecommunications system and method is disclosed for optimizing multi-party calls within a satellite network. This can be accomplished by the Mobile Switching Center (MSC) that the subscriber is currently registered in receiving a multi-party request from the subscriber and determining the most optimal MSC for the given multi-party call. The subscriber can then be re-registered in the most optimal MSC, and either the subscriber or the optimal MSC can set up the entire multi-party call. Alternatively, the subscriber can be re-registered in the optimal MSC, which then sets up the call to the first party of the multi-party call. Thereafter, the subscriber can set up the rest of the multi-party call.
